Dental Assistant Salary in Cumberland, RI: $47,422 (2026)
Quick Answer:A full-time dental assistant in Cumberland, RI earns a median $47,422/year (≈ $22.79/hour) in nominal terms for 2026 — projected from BLS OEWS 2025 (SOC 31-9091). Once you factor in Cumberland's price level (1% above national, BEA RPP 100.5), that paycheck buys what $47,186 would nationally. Nominal pay sits 4.8% below the Rhode Island state average.

Salary Breakdown
| Percentile | Annual | Hourly |
|---|---|---|
| Entry Level (P10) | $38,423 | $18.47 |
| Lower Range (P25) | $44,540 | $21.41 |
| Median (P50)(typical) | $47,422 | $22.79 |
| Upper Range (P75) | $57,434 | $27.61 |
| Top Earners (P90) | $58,947 | $28.34 |

Salary Trajectory for Dental Assistants in Cumberland (2019–2027)
2019–2025: actual BLS OEWS data for this metro area. 2026+: CAGR 3.14% projection.
| Year | Annual Salary | Status |
|---|---|---|
| 2019 | $38,336 | Actual |
| 2020 | $39,388 | Actual |
| 2021 | $36,978 | Actual |
| 2022 | $42,869 | Actual |
| 2023 | $44,515 | Actual |
| 2024 | $43,998 | Actual |
| 2025 | $45,978 | Actual |
| 2026(current) | $47,422 | Estimated |
| 2027 | $48,911 | Projected |
Based on 7 years of BLS OEWS data for the Cumberland metropolitan area, the median dental assistant salary grew 19.9% from $38,336 (2019) to $45,978 (2025). At a 3.14% compound annual growth rate, salaries are projected to reach $48,911 by 2027 — a total increase of $10,575 (27.59%) from 2019.

Dental Assistant Job Market in Cumberland
Analyzing the local job market reveals a total of eight dental assistants currently employed in the Cumberland area, which suggests a relatively small yet stable workforce. The cost of living index at 100.5 indicates a slightly higher than average living expense compared to the national average, impacting overall take-home pay. Among different employer types, general dental practices, especially those affiliated with larger DSOs like Heartland and Aspen, tend to offer some of the highest salaries due to their structured pay scales. The disparity in salaries can often be attributed to specialization; dental assistants working in oral surgery or orthodontic practices typically command higher wages, while those in general dental settings earn less. To maximize earnings in Cumberland, pursuing an Expanded Function Dental Assistant (EFDA) credential, considering hybrid roles such as treatment coordinators, and seeking employment with larger DSO chains could effectively enhance job prospects and compensation in this evolving landscape.
